Skills, Responsibilities & Benefits

Key skills and qualifications: Occupational Therapy, Patient Evaluation, Treatment Planning, Collaboration, Documentation, Communication, Leadership, Teamwork. Candidates with experience in these areas may be especially well-suited for this Occupational Therapy role.

Core responsibilities: The Occupational Therapist evaluates and treats patients, develops individualized treatment plans, and collaborates closely with families and the interdisciplinary care team. This role also includes supervising Occupational Therapy Assistants to ensure high-quality, patient-centered care.
